About Miss Dorothy and Her Book Mobile
From Gloria Houston and Susan Condie Lamb comes the true story of Miss Dorothy, an enterprising and dedicated librarian who drove a bookmobile to bring books to her neighbors in Appalachia, in this companion volume to My Great-Aunt Arizona. This nonfiction picture book is an excellent choice to share during homeschooling, in particular for children ages 6 to 8. It’s a fun way to learn to read and as a supplement for activity books for children.
Dorothy's dearest wish is to be a librarian in a fine brick library just like the one she visited when she was small. But her new home in North Carolina has valleys and streams but no libraries, so Miss Dorothy and her neighbors decide to start a bookmobile. Instead of people coming to a fine brick library, Miss Dorothy can now bring the books to them—at school, on the farm, even once in the middle of a river!
About the Author
Dr. Gloria Houston, known internationally as an educator and an author of multi-award winning best sellers for young readers as well as textbooks, died peacefully after a long battle with cancer on Monday March 21st, 2016 at her daughter's home in Apollo Beach, Florida. She was 75. Dr. Houston wrote over 10 books that were published in numerous languages. Her books have won and been listed on more than forty awards and awards lists. Over the years, she taught at the University of South Florida and Western Carolina University and was lovingly referred to as "Ms. Mack" in earlier years teaching in Florida and Texas schools grades K-12. She frequently identified herself as "first, last and always, a teacher." Her books are filled with Appalachian mountain history and culture with great attention to detail woven throughout the characters and scenery with many of the character's based on her relatives. Her "Littlejim" series are books about her father, J. Myron Houston's life and "The Year of the Perfect Christmas Tree" features her Mother, Ruth Houston, as the main character. She penned a tribute to teachers in "My Great Aunt Arizona", a story about her Aunt Arizona Hughes, and librarians are the stars of "Miss Dorothy and Her Bookmobile". In each book she wrote of her childhood experiences and stories handed down through her family and community. Dr. Houston was designated as a Distinguished Educator by the International Reading Association. She won the National Excellence in Literacy Education Award, and was named a Distinguished Alumni at Appalachian State University. She is listed in Who's Who in America, Outstanding Women of the Twenty-First Century, Who's Who in the Southwest, Who's Who in Education, International Who's Who of Authors, Something about the Author, Contemporary Authors as well as other references.
